My Buying Guides on Hp Prodesk 600 G2 Sff Test

What I Looked for First

When I started checking the HP ProDesk 600 G2 SFF test unit, my first focus was on overall condition, performance, and whether it still felt reliable for everyday work. I wanted a small form factor desktop that could handle basic office tasks, web browsing, and multitasking without slowing me down.

Performance I Expected

My main expectation was smooth day-to-day use. In my experience, this model is best suited for tasks like document editing, email, video calls, and light multitasking. I paid attention to how quickly it booted, how responsive it felt, and whether it could keep up when I opened several apps at once.

Design and Size

I liked that the SFF design saves space on my desk. If you need a compact PC for a home office or business setup, this size is practical. I found it easier to place under a monitor or beside a workstation without taking up too much room.

Ports and Connectivity

I always check the available ports before buying, and this model gave me enough options for typical office use. I looked for USB ports, display outputs, and audio connections so I could connect my keyboard, mouse, monitor, and other accessories without trouble.

Upgrade Potential

One thing I considered was how easy it would be to upgrade later. For me, a desktop like this becomes more valuable if I can add more RAM or storage when needed. I think that makes it a smarter buy, especially if I want to extend its life.

Condition of the Test Unit

Since this is a test or used unit, I paid close attention to wear and tear. I checked for scratches, fan noise, startup issues, and any signs of hardware problems. My advice is to make sure the system has been tested properly before you buy.

Value for Money

In my opinion, the HP ProDesk 600 G2 SFF can be a good budget-friendly choice if the price is right. I would only recommend it if it is offered at a fair cost compared to newer models and if it still meets your daily needs.

Who I Think It Is Best For

I see this desktop as a solid option for students, office workers, and anyone who needs a dependable basic PC. It may not be the best choice for heavy gaming or demanding creative work, but for standard productivity, it can still be a useful machine.

My Final Buying Advice

If I were buying the HP ProDesk 600 G2 SFF test unit, I would focus on condition, speed, upgrade options, and price. For me, the best deal is one that feels reliable, fits my workspace, and performs well for the tasks I actually do every day.
